Elden Ring Shadow of the Erdtree’s NPCs Look Like This Without Their Armor
Elden Ring's Shadow of the Erdtree DLC has some terrifying NPCs, and a dataminer has made them look significantly less intimidating by showcasing what the character models inside their armor look like. While some of these Elden Ring Shadow of the Erdtree DLC NPCs have pretty basic models, others have some really interesting characteristics that resonate with their lore.
Just like the other Soulsborne games, the lore has been one of the biggest talking points of Elden Ring apart from, of course, the difficulty. The lore is so intricate at times that players only get to know part of the story from the in-game cues, and the rest is dissected by the dataminers. Recently, a dataminer revealed what's inside the armor of Elden Ring Shadow of the Erdtree DLC's horrifying Divine Beast Dancing Lion boss. Now, another creator has gone a step further and dissected some more characters from the expansion.
In a new video, YouTuber and Soulsborne dataminer Zullie the Witch reveals some interesting details about the NPCs in Elden Ring. The video showcases the Elden Ring Shadow of the Erdtree NPCs without their armor, and it is actually quite impressive to see the amount of effort FromSoftware has put behind each of these characters, despite a lot of the features not being visible to the naked eye. Fans have been fascinated by the raw appearance many of the NPCs have, starting with Moore, with several players saying he looked exactly as they had imagined.
Elden Ring Fans Impressed With The Meticulousness Of NPC Character Models
Redmane Freyja's model is quite interesting too, as her face is scarred by Scarlet Rot. This aligns with her lore in the game, and it is quite a nice detail to have considering players don't really see what's inside the armor in the game. Players have also highlighted that one of the NPCs players find in Elden Ring's Volcano Manor, Tanith, shares striking similarities with Dancer of Ranah, which again is quite apt considering Tanith was a dancer before becoming Rykard's consort.
That being said, there are a few surprising aspects as well. For instance, Hornsent doesn't actually have horns for some reason, but the dataminer adds that it was probably not added as the character would need a unique model altogether for that. On the other hand, fans have added that along with Elden Ring's Shadow of the Erdtree DLC's new hairstyle options, horn customizations should also have been added with the expansion.
